Growing up, I was a big proponent of the "Door are overrated, Morrison's poetry sucks" contingent, but now than I'm more than grown, I'll only abide by the "Morrison's poetry sucks" part. That band could cook. I've become a big fan of Morrison Hotel, in particular. The songs are short, concise, and fully arranged with a minimum of overdubs. It's most things garage rock was meant to be without the stupid lyrics about "little girls" who broke some pimply faced, greasy haired singer's heart. OK, Morrison manages to squeeze in a little bit of bad poetry, but I'm telling you: this album is a classic rock masterpiece.
You're on your own for those 10-minute poetry suites, "Riders on the Storm", and a lot of other stuff I still don't like.
